Sec. 15-606. Property removed from safe-deposit box. Property removed from a safe-deposit box and delivered under this Act to the administrator under this Act is subject to the holder's right to reimbursement for the cost of opening the box and a lien or contract providing reimbursement to the holder for unpaid rent charges for the box. Upon application by the holder, and after there are sufficient cash funds available either from the contents of the box or the sale of the property, the administrator shall reimburse the holder from the proceeds. The administrator shall promulgate administrative rules concerning the reimbursement process under this Section.
